Starting an online casino in 2026 typically costs between $200,000 and $1.2 million, depending on licensing jurisdiction, platform architecture, game providers, compliance requirements, and marketing scale.
An online casino is a licensed digital gambling platform that operates under specific regulatory frameworks and requires significant upfront and ongoing investment to remain compliant and profitable.
This guide provides a detailed breakdown of online casino startup costs, including licensing fees, casino software development, game integration, payment processing, compliance, and marketing. It is designed for entrepreneurs and investors evaluating white label versus custom casino platforms with a focus on ROI and long-term scalability.
The global iGaming industry continues to expand rapidly, driven by increasing digital adoption and the growth of regulated online gambling markets worldwide, according to Statista. However, profitability depends heavily on licensing quality, operational costs, and technology choices made at the planning stage.
If you are evaluating how much does it cost to start an online casino, the initial investment typically ranges between $200,000 and $1.2 million, depending on licensing jurisdiction, software architecture, game portfolio, compliance requirements, and marketing scale.
This cost range reflects the combined expenses required to launch a legally compliant and operational online casino platform, not just the technology layer.

Beyond initial setup, online casino operators should budget for ongoing annual operating expenses that often reach low six figures, depending on platform scale and market focus. These recurring costs typically include server maintenance, staff salaries, compliance renewals, payment processing fees, and continuous marketing spend.
Understanding these baseline and recurring costs is essential when assessing how much does it cost to start an online casino that remains compliant, scalable, and financially sustainable from day one.
When evaluating how much does it cost to start an online casino in the EU, licensing jurisdiction is one of the most decisive cost drivers. European licenses offer high credibility, but they also introduce stricter compliance requirements and higher upfront investment compared to offshore options. These considerations differ significantly from regulated US markets, where Online Casino Platform Providers in Pennsylvania must comply with state-specific gaming laws, platform certifications, and operator partnerships.
Among EU-focused operators, Malta and Curaçao are the most commonly compared jurisdictions due to their contrasting cost structures, regulatory depth, and market access.
Malta is considered one of the most reputable licensing jurisdictions in Europe. Casinos licensed by the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) benefit from strong player trust, broad payment provider acceptance, and regulatory recognition across the EU.
Estimated Cost
Starting an online casino under a Malta license typically costs $100,000 to $150,000, including license application fees, legal advisory, compliance setup, and regulatory audits.

The total cost to start an online casino in the EU depends on whether you prioritize regulatory credibility or cost efficiency. Licenses such as Malta, Isle of Man, or UKGC require higher upfront investment but provide stronger market access and trust. Jurisdictions like Curaçao or Kahnawake reduce launch costs but limit banking and affiliate scalability within Europe.
Your decision should align with long-term market focus, budget flexibility, and growth strategy.
When calculating how much does it cost to start an online casino, platform strategy plays a major role in budget control. Turnkey and white label casino platforms allow operators to launch faster by bundling software, game integrations, licensing assistance, and payment gateways into a single solution.
These platforms can significantly reduce upfront costs, often bringing launch budgets closer to $200,000 instead of exceeding $1 million, especially for first time operators.

Affiliate marketing is one of the most effective ways to scale an online casino while controlling acquisition costs. When evaluating how much does it cost to start an online casino or how quickly profitability can be achieved, affiliate programs offer a proven, performance-based growth model with minimal upfront risk.
Casino affiliate programs operate on a results-driven structure. Operators pay affiliates only when measurable outcomes occur, such as player registrations, first deposits, or net revenue generation.
This model aligns acquisition spending directly with revenue performance.

Consider a revenue share commission of 30 percent.
If a referred player generates $500 in net losses in a month, the affiliate earns $150, while the casino retains the remaining revenue.
When scaled across hundreds of referred players, affiliate marketing becomes a high-ROI acquisition channel with limited upfront cost.
This performance-based structure is especially valuable when managing casino game development costs and other fixed operational expenses, since acquisition spend is directly tied to revenue generation.

Understanding how much does it cost to start an online casino is only part of the decision. Long-term success depends on whether that investment can generate sustainable profitability. Calculating return on investment (ROI) helps operators assess whether their casino business model is viable, scalable, and efficient.
There is no single formula that guarantees returns, but ROI can be evaluated using a simple framework.
Net Profit
Total Revenue minus Total Costs
Total Investment
Initial setup costs plus ongoing operational expenses over a defined period
If an operator invests $500,000 over 12 months and generates $800,000 in total revenue, the net profit would be $300,000.
This level of return is considered strong within the iGaming industry, given its regulatory complexity, operational risk, and competitive acquisition costs.
Online casinos that are strategic about licensing, marketing efficiency, and player retention typically reach breakeven within 12 to 24 months.

Most online casinos take 3 to 6 months to launch. Timelines depend on licensing approval, software readiness, payment gateway onboarding, and compliance verification. White-label platforms typically launch faster than custom-built solutions.

No. Operating an online casino without a gambling license is illegal in most jurisdictions and prevents access to payment processors, banking partners, and reputable affiliates. A valid license is required for legal operation and long-term scalability.
